getoverit Legit VIP Sep 23, 2013 #1 is there a strong tp on 53w and 78w? c/band or ku?and which lbn is required.linear or circular thanks.

Costactc Sat Junkie Administrator Sep 23, 2013 #2 Here you go: Intelsat 23 at 53w- 3933 V 4340 and requires a circular feed so plate will need to be inserted into your lnbf. Simon Bolivar at 78w- 3885 V 23000, plate not necessary as is regular linear.

cpr43 Legit VIP Sep 23, 2013 #3 78W Venesat C band 3886 V 23000 Ku UNIVERSAL 11512 V 3100 I have never stop at 53W
